Abstract :
This practical approach of implementing the third service as importance in the IEEE 802.21 standard for media independent handover (MIH) deals with several methods of implementation and comparison between them for different processing architectures. The IEEE 802.21 standard states two methods of implementing a Media Independent Service. Every of these two methods has advantages and disadvantages, explained and detailed in this paper, especially for embedded programming engineers. I simulated a media independent information service implementation under the two specified methods and extracted the main points of the transmission and their impact on the processing power required for each.
